Getting a signed contract has long been the moment estate agents celebrate. But the government’s home buying and selling reform roadmap makes a compelling case that this is the wrong finish line. If a transaction takes an average of 120 days to complete after offer acceptance – 60% longer than it took in 2007 – something in the process isn’t working. The question for your agency is whether you’re ready to shift how you think about what success looks like.
Kotini and the Open Property Data Association
The Open Property Data Association, founded in April 2023, aims to improve property transactions by promoting the sharing and use of trusted open property data. Their Property Data Trust Framework (PDTF) provides a common language for the industry, enhancing collaboration and transparency. We’re using it to help agents keep compliant.
